On Board Diagnostics
ŶꢀꢀHeat Pump Over Temperature Protection:
In HEAT PUMP Mode, or Heat Pump and Furnace
Mode, if the indoor coil reaches a temperature above
125°F (52°C), the display will flash both the HEAT
PUMP icon and either 99°F or 99°C on the display.
While Over Temperature Protection is activated, the
compressor will not run. It is recommended to increase
airflow by cleaning the filter and opening the vents.
